Wolverine Airsoft Heretic Labs Speed Trigger Assembly
Features:
- CNC-machined aluminum construction for strength and precision
- Delrin bearing for ultra-smooth, frictionless trigger movement
- Three-way adjustability: pre-travel, post-travel, and actuation point
- Includes lighter 50% tension spring for fast, hair-trigger response
- Drop-in compatible with MTW and Heretic Labs platforms
- Tool-free installation with self-retaining trigger clip
Product Description:
The Heretic Labs Speed Trigger by Wolverine Airsoft is designed for the fastest, most responsive shooting experience in airsoft. Whether you're dominating in competitive speedsoft or fine-tuning your build for milsim, this CNC-machined aluminum trigger delivers precision performance and a crisp, tactile feel. Equipped with a Delrin bearing and a 50% lighter spring, it enables ultra-fast follow-up shots while maintaining full control. With three-point adjustability and a tool-free retention clip, the trigger is easy to install and personalize to your preferences.
Product Specifications:
Color: Midnight Black, Ultramarine Blue, and Blood Red
Material: 6061 CNC Aluminum with Delrin Bearing
Compatibility: Wolverine HPA airsoft rifles
Manufacturer: Wolverine
